Microsoft introduced Power Bi in 2013.
Ever since its inception, the program has become a go-to solution for businesses looking for analytics, reporting, embedded analytics, and data set visualization.
But then again, we can’t say that it’s the ultimate or the only solution for companies out there, regardless of whether these platforms are real life or operate in an online-only capacity.
There are so many options out there.
And the way that technology keeps evolving, alongside ever growing business requirements, there are tons of alternatives to Power Bi tool.
The good news is that each promising to turn your data into actionable insights. But not every platform fits every need, especially when you’re looking to embed analytics directly into your own applications.
That being said, we wanted to double down on Power BI Embedded, Microsoft’s solution for integrating analytics into third-party apps, and go through its features to evaluate the software in more depth. The idea is to lay out all the deliverables and use-cases that Power Bi embed is capable of, and then suggest different options that could be a better fit for your business.
What Is Power BI Embedded?
Before we get into discussing whether it’s right for you, let’s clarify what Power BI Embedded actually does.
Power BI itself is Microsoft’s business intelligence platform, offering dashboards, reports, and data visualizations.
As a result, the program takes that functionality and lets developers bake it directly into their own applications. So instead of forcing users to switch between your app and a separate analytics tool, they get insights right where they’re already working.
This is especially useful for:
- Software vendors (ISVs) who want to add analytics to their products without building them from scratch.
- Businesses that need custom reporting inside their internal tools.
- Developers who want to provide interactive dashboards without reinventing the wheel.
But like any tool, it has its strengths and weaknesses. Let’s look at both sides.
The Good Stuff: Why You Might Love Power BI Embedded
Of all the good reasons as to why this might be the better option for you, here’s some useful stuff that you need to know:
1. It Gets Regular Updates
Microsoft doesn’t let Power BI sit still. Every month, they roll out new features, fixes, and improvements. Even better, they actually listen to user feedback. There’s a whole community where people suggest (and vote on) new features, and the most popular ones often make it into updates.
If you like knowing your software is constantly evolving, this is a big plus.
2. You Get Tons of Visualizations
Out of the box, Power BI comes with all the standard charts, graphs, and tables you’d expect. But where it really shines is in custom visuals. Developers have built specialized visualizations for everything from financial KPIs to geographic heat maps.
Want a waterfall chart for your sales pipeline? There’s a visual for that. Need an interactive map to track regional performance? Yep, that too.
3. Excel Fans Will Feel Right at Home
If your team lives in spreadsheets, Power BI makes the transition smoother. You can import Excel files directly, and the interface has a familiar feel. That said, once you see how much faster and more interactive Power BI is, you might not want to go back.
4. It Plays Nice with Other Data Sources
Power BI doesn’t force you into a Microsoft-only world. It connects to:
- SQL databases
- Google Analytics
- Azure cloud services
- JSON, XML, and other file formats
- And even big data sources
So if your data is scattered across different platforms, Power BI can pull it all together.
5. Dashboards Are Actually Interactive
Static reports are boring. Power BI lets users filter, drill down, and explore data on the fly. Drag-and-drop functionality makes it easy to tweak visuals without needing a developer.
The Not-So-Good: Where Power BI Embedded Falls Short
Of course, no tool is perfect. Here’s where Power BI Embedded might frustrate you.
1. The Pricing Is Confusing (and Unpredictable)
This is one of the biggest complaints. Unlike some competitors that charge per user or per report, Power BI Embedded pricing is based on “capacity”—meaning how much computing power you need.
The problem? It’s hard to predict your exact costs upfront. If your usage spikes, so does your bill. For businesses that like predictable expenses, this can be a dealbreaker.
2. There’s a Steep Learning Curve
If you’re just importing data and making simple reports, Power BI is pretty straightforward. But if you need advanced analytics, be prepared to learn:
- Power Query (for data transformations)
- DAX (Microsoft’s formula language)
- M Language (for data modeling)
These aren’t the most intuitive languages, and they’re very different from SQL, which most analysts already know.
3. Customizing Visuals Can Be a Headache
While Power BI has a lot of visuals out of the box, tweaking them to look exactly how you want isn’t always easy. If you need pixel-perfect reports with custom branding, you might hit some limitations.
4. Complex Data Models Get Messy
Power BI handles simple table relationships just fine. But if your data has multiple connections between tables, things get tricky. You might end up creating extra fields just to make joins work—which isn’t ideal.
5. Formulas Can Be Finicky
DAX (Power BI’s formula language) is powerful, but it has quirks. For example, concatenating more than two fields requires nested statements—something that’s simple in SQL but clunky here.
Is Power BI Embedded Analytics the Right Tool for Your Business Needs?
Given these pros and cons, here’s who might benefit most from Power BI Embedded:
Microsoft-heavy businesses (If you’re already using Azure, Office 365, or SQL Server, Power BI fits right in.)
Developers who need embedded analytics fast (It’s quicker than building from scratch.)
Teams that need interactive dashboards (The visualization options are strong.)
On the flip side, you might want a Power BI alternative if:
- You need predictable, simple pricing (The capacity-based model isn’t for everyone.)
- Your team hates learning new languages (DAX and M aren’t beginner-friendly.)
- You have super complex data relationships (Other tools handle this better.)
Top Power BI Alternatives to Consider
If Power BI Embedded isn’t quite right, here are some other options worth checking out:
1. Dotnet Report
- Best for: Adhoc reporting, free trial, real time data, and embedding
- Downside: Nothing in particular
2. Tableau Embedded Analytics
- Best for: Stunning, highly customizable visuals
- Downside: Expensive, and the learning curve is steep
3. Looker (Google Cloud)
- Best for: Businesses deep in the Google ecosystem
- Downside: Less flexible if you’re not using BigQuery
4. Sisense
- Best for: Handling large, complex datasets
- Downside: Can be overkill for simple needs
5. Qlik Sense
- Best for: Associative data modeling (finding hidden insights)
- Downside: The interface feels outdated compared to others
6. Domo
- Best for: Real-time dashboards and mobile access
- Downside: Pricing isn’t transparent
Final Thoughts: Is Power BI Embedded Right for You?
Power BI Embedded is a solid choice if you’re already in the Microsoft world and need to integrate analytics into your apps. The monthly updates, wide range of visuals, and strong data connectivity make it a powerful tool.
But if you’re put off by the confusing pricing, complex data modeling, or the need to learn DAX, a Power BI alternative might be a better fit.
Speaking of alternative tools, or something along the lines of the best Power bi alternative, Dotnet Report is the perfect solution for a multitude of businesses.
Let’s take a closer look at how both programs stack up against each other.
Amazing Features Built In
Transform your data into actionable insights with dotnet Report Builder’s powerful analytics. Our Ad Hoc Report Builder includes many advanced features
Dotnet Report Vs Microsoft Power Bi Embed
Choosing between Power BI and Dotnet Report for embedded analytics is like deciding between a Swiss Army knife and a specialized tool.
Both get the job done, as far as getting around basic level requirements.
However, when you compare both tools in a larger environment—one that involves datasets, real-time information, and higher business demands—you’ll notice several key differences between the two platforms.
If you’re staring at these two options wondering which one deserves your time (and budget), this breakdown will help. We’ll look at pricing, ease of use, customization, and real-world performance—without the marketing fluff.
The Basics: What Each Tool Does
Power BI Embedded
Microsoft’s Power BI Embedded is designed for developers and businesses that need to integrate analytics into their own applications. It’s part of the broader Power BI ecosystem, which includes desktop, cloud, and mobile versions.
- Best for: Companies already using Microsoft products (Azure, Office 365, SQL Server).
- Key strength: Deep analytics with interactive dashboards and AI-powered insights.
- Biggest drawback: Complicated pricing and a steep learning curve for advanced features.
Dotnet Report
Dotnet Report is a reporting tool built specifically for developers who need to add self-service reporting to their applications.
It’s has more use-cases varying over multi-sized businesses – and that too over different niches. And yes, if you love .NET environments, you’ll grow to like everything that Dotnet Report has to offer.
- Best for: SaaS providers, multi niche industries, developers, business managers looking for a fuss free ad hoc reporting system and vice versa.
- Key strength: Easy integration and embedding, alongside straightforward pricing.
- Biggest drawback: Limited advanced analytics compared to Power BI.
Now, let’s break down how they compare in the areas that actually matter.
1. Pricing: Which One Fits Your Budget?
Power BI Embedded: Flexible but Confusing
Power BI Embedded operates on a capacity-based pricing model, meaning you pay for computing power rather than per user.
- Free tier: Very limited features
- Paid plans: Start at $14/user/month for basic cloud access, but embedded pricing depends on Azure resources.
- Hidden costs: If your usage spikes, so does your bill.
The biggest frustration? Predicting costs is tough. You might start small, but scaling up can get expensive fast.
Dotnet Report: Simpler, More Predictable
Dotnet Report offers clear, per-user pricing, which is easier to budget for.
- Free trial available
- Paid plans: All paid plan details are available on request. Dotnet Report has a flexible pricing structure and varies on a case-by-case basis. This is done to ensure that every company can be accommodated without having them go overboard with expenses..
- No surprise costs: You know exactly what you’re paying each month.
Winner? If you hate unpredictable bills, Dotnet Report is the safer choice. But if you need enterprise-grade analytics and don’t mind Microsoft’s pricing quirks, Power BI might still win out.
2. Ease of Use: Which One Won’t Make You Pull Your Hair Out?
Power BI: Powerful but Complex
Power BI is easy for basic reporting—drag and drop, connect to data, and you’re done. But once you need more advanced features, things get messy.
- DAX language: Required for complex calculations, and it’s not intuitive.
- Multiple tools to learn: Power BI Desktop, Service, Report Server—each has its own quirks.
- Steep learning curve: Training is almost mandatory for non-technical users.
Dotnet Report: Built for All Kinds of Users
Dotnet Report is more of a means to an end – an out of the box, flexible and super responsive solution which anyone can use.
You don’t have to be a hardcore software developer to understand the platform’s features, and even the least tech savvy person can easily get going with Dotnet Report within the first 10 – 20 mins.
- No new languages to learn: Uses familiar frameworks.
- Simpler UI: More focused on quick report generation than deep analytics.
- Less training needed: Business users can create reports without heavy IT support.
Winner? If your team isn’t full of data scientists, Dotnet Report is easier to adopt. Power BI’s depth comes at the cost of complexity.
3. Customization & Flexibility: Which One Lets You Do More?
Power BI: Endless Options (If You Can Handle Them)
- Custom visuals: Huge library, plus the ability to build your own.
- Advanced filtering: Drill-downs, cross-filtering, and AI-powered insights.
- White-labeling: Possible, but requires extra setup.
The downside? Overkill for simple needs. If you just need basic reports, Power BI’s flexibility might feel like unnecessary bloat.
Adhoc Reporting System: Streamlined for Simplicity
- Built-in report designer: Less flexible than Power BI but easier for non-technical users.
- Good for standard reports: Charts, tables, and dashboards work well out of the box.
Winner? Power BI wins on raw capability, but Dotnet Report is better if you just need functional, no-frills reporting.
At the end of the day, the right tool depends on your specific needs—how technical your team is, what your budget looks like, and how much customization you require.
Have you tried Power BI Embedded? What was your experience? Or did you find a better fit elsewhere? Let me know in the comments!
Ready to see more of our Reporting Solution?
To see what our modern and intuitive report builder can do for your Company and how it can benefit your Business, please pick a time to schedule a meeting with our development team for a detailed discussion.